摘要

Ventilation ratio is one of the important factors that affect the sheltering efficiency of wind barrier.Under the protection of wind barriers,it gained the aerodynamic coefficients of vehicles on bridge deck via the wind tunnel test of the scale section model.The natural wind,vehicle and bridge were regarded as an interacting system,and a three-dimensional analytical model for wind-vehicle-bridge coupling vibration system was presented.The judging criteria for the running safety of vehicle are proposed according to the dynamic response of vehicles.It has investigated the effects of ventilation ratios of wind barrier on the running safety of vehicles.Results show it is surely wind barrier,provided a ventilation rate of 50%,will achieve the purpose of protecting the running safety of vehicles.
